Cat Wilson

Lighting And Projection Designer For The Academy at The Joffrey Ballet

Cat Wilson serves as an Assistant Professor of Lighting Design and Lighting Designer at Point Park University since 2013, contributing expertise to productions such as "A Streetcar Named Desire" and "Urinetown." Additionally, Cat has worked as a Lighting Designer for Goodman Theatre since 2017 on "Yasmina's Necklace" and has significant freelance experience from 2008 onward. Notable projects include lighting designs for Kokandy Productions, The Joffrey Ballet, and Li Chiao-Ping Dance Company. Cat also holds a Master of Fine Arts in Lighting Design from Carnegie Mellon University and a BFA in Psychology and Technical Theatre from Tufts University.
